Henry Receives Political Donor Measure

Governor Henry has on his desk a bill that would ban political contributions from legal judgments or settlements.
The bill was filed following a series of articles in The Oklahoman about contributions made by cliernts to political committees operated by attorneys.
The Senate approved the bill on Wednesday.
Senate President Pro Tem Glenn Coffee said the bill was filled following the reports that money from workers' compensation awards was funneled into the political process by plaintiff attorneys without the knowledge of injured workers.
House Bill 1601 passed on a 26-22 party-line vote.
